Kesha and Reneé Rapp cover Tik Tok and blast P Diddy

Kesha joined Reneé Rapp for a cover of ‘TiK ToK’ at Coachella – and blasted P Diddy in the lyrics.

The ‘Woman’ hitmaker was among a host of guests who joined the ‘Mean Girls’ star for her set at the Outdoor Theatre at the California festival on Sunday (14.04.24), also including original cast members of ‘The L Word’ and Towa Bird.

Katherine Moennig, Leisha Hailey, Jennifer Beals and Ilene Chaiken from the hit noughties programme, which follows the lives of a group of lesbian and bisexual women who live in West Hollywood, introduced the star to the stage and declared ‘The L Word’ her “favourite show”.

Around the halfway point, Kesha, 37, walked out onstage donning a top with ‘I Am Mother’ emblazoned across it, and Reneé, 24, hailed her “the hottest person on the Earth”.

She told the crowd: “Ladies and gentlemen, this I think is the hottest person on the Earth. Everybody put your ******* hands together for Kesha.”

Amid disgraced 54-year-old rapper Diddy’s sexual assault scandal, Kesha switched the ‘Tik Tok’ line “Wake up in the morning feeling like P. Diddy” to “Wake up in the morning like f*** P. Diddy.”

Towa Bird joined Reneé for ‘Tummy Hurts’ towards the end of the set.

It’s not the first time Kesha has adapted the track.

Kesha dropped Diddy’s name during her performance at the Fox Theater in Oakland, California, in November, as allegations against him emerged.

She sang: “Wake up in the morning feeling just like me.”
